Jeffrey J. Tafel, CAE, is the President of NAFTZ. He is a member and mission-focused non-profit professional with nearly 30 years of association senior management experience and specializes in developing and executing strategy.

Previously, Jeff served as the CEO of the Home Builders Association of Western Michigan where he worked closely with the Board of Directors and oversaw the entire organization, it’s programs and initiatives. Serving Kalamazoo and the six surrounding counties (including the cities of Kalamazoo, Battle Creek, Three Rivers, Coldwater, Albion, Hastings, South Haven and Allegan), the HBA serves and represents the entire residential construction and remodeling community.

Prior to HBA, Jeff served as the Executive Director of the IFMA (International Facility Management Association) Foundation where he led the organization out of near extinction to become a relevant, self-sustaining entity.  He was responsible for creation of the IFMA Foundation’s Global Workforce Initiative to encourage Facility Management as a career of choice. He also served the members of IFMA as director of membership and councils where he worked with the more than 130 chapters and special interest groups of IFMA around the world helping local volunteer boards to implement successful strategic plans and best practices to increase member value.

In his volunteer life, he’s served on the board of directors of the Association Foundation Group, the Texas Society of Association Executives, Houston Society of Association Executives and was an active volunteer for the Council of Engineering and Scientific Society Executives. He holds the Certified Association Executive credential from the American Society of Association Executives and a b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ering from Michigan Technological University.  In other words, he’s an association geek.
